The Foundation of Modern Farming: Understanding Transgenic Seeds

 

Beyond Conventional Breeding: A Deep Dive into the Transgenic Seeds Market The evolution of agriculture has continuously sought ways to enhance productivity and resilience. Today, a pivotal element in this ongoing quest is the development and adoption of seeds with modified genetic characteristics. These advanced planting materials are the result of sophisticated biotechnology, allowing for the precise introduction of traits that offer distinct advantages over traditional varieties. This technology forms the bedrock of the contemporary global agricultural system, providing solutions to persistent challenges like pest infestation and weed competition.

One of the primary drivers of the market is the imperative to address global food security concerns. With a rapidly expanding world population, maximizing crop yields from existing arable land is crucial. These modified seeds play a vital role by offering enhanced agronomic performance, which translates directly into better harvests for farmers. The introduction of traits like insect resistance and herbicide tolerance simplifies farming practices, leading to greater efficiency and reduced operational complexities.

The ongoing transformation in farming practices, moving towards precision agriculture, further supports the expanding adoption of this technology. Precision methods, which rely on data and localized management, are perfectly complemented by seeds engineered for predictable performance under specific conditions. This synergy is a key factor influencing the overall Growth trajectory of the industry. The benefits extend beyond the farm gate, impacting supply chains and ultimately contributing to the availability of staple crops worldwide. As research continues to advance, the potential for new traits—such as those offering tolerance to extreme environmental conditions—promises to keep this sector at the forefront of agricultural innovation. The continued investment in research and development is indicative of the future potential of this technology to reshape global crop production.

FAQs:

  • Q: What is the main difference between transgenic seeds and conventional seeds?

    • A: The main difference lies in how the traits are acquired. Conventional breeding involves crossing plants to achieve desired traits over many generations, while transgenic seeds have specific, beneficial genes (often from another species) introduced directly into their DNA using modern biotechnology for targeted trait expression.

  • Q: Do transgenic seeds require different farming equipment?

    • A: Generally, no. Transgenic seeds are designed to be integrated into existing agricultural systems. However, their use is often associated with modern farming techniques, including precision agriculture, which can utilize advanced equipment like GPS-guided machinery and specialized planting tools.
